Problem
Micro LED display technology faces challenges in increasing pixel density due to size restrictions and required spacing between adjacent Micro LEDs.
Innovation Solution
A display panel design featuring a base substrate with a defining layer and light-emitting devices, where the defining layer has openings for multiple light-emitting devices of different colors, allowing for increased pixel density by stacking light-emitting devices and optimizing their placement on bearing surfaces.

If Micro LED display technology is used, then power consumption is reduced and product life is extended, but pixel density cannot be increased due to size restrictions
Solution Approach 1:
The patent transitions from a two-dimensional planar arrangement of Micro LEDs to a three-dimensional stacked configuration. Multiple light-emitting devices are arranged vertically along the thickness direction, with first light-emitting devices and second light-emitting devices positioned at different heights. This dimensional change allows multiple pixels to occupy the same lateral footprint area, thereby increasing pixel density without requiring smaller individual Micro LED components.

If multiple light-emitting devices are stacked to increase pixel density, then the transfer process becomes more complex, but the patent simplifies it through bearing surfaces
Solution Approach 1:
The patent introduces bearing surfaces as intermediary structures on the substrate to facilitate the transfer and positioning of stacked light-emitting devices. These bearing surfaces provide mechanical support and alignment references, enabling precise placement of multiple devices without requiring complex transfer processes. The bearing surfaces act as mediators between the substrate and the stacked light-emitting devices, simplifying the manufacturing process while maintaining high pixel density.

A display panel includes a base substate, a defining layer, and a light-emitting device. The defining layer is located over one side of the base substrate and includes a defining part and an opening between defining parts. The opening includes a first opening and a second opening. The defining part has a side surface. The side surface has a first side surface and a second side surface. The side surface also has a first bearing surface between the first side surface and the second side surface. The light-emitting device is located in the opening. The light-emitting device has a first light-emitting device located in the first opening and a second light-emitting device located in the second opening. The first light-emitting device and the second light-emitting device are light-emitting devices of different colors. Moreover, at least a portion of the second light-emitting device is disposed over the first bearing surface.
